Allan Dudley Cruickshank (1907 ? 1974) was an American ornithologist and writer. He wrote many books about birds and was the National Audubon Society's official photographer and a staff member for 37 years. Helen Cruickshank (1902 ? 1994) was an American nature writer and photographer of birds in their natural habitats in many areas of the world. She won the 1949 John Burroughs Medal for her 1948 book, Flight into Sunshine: Bird Experiences in Florida. Brevard County, Florida established the Helen and Allan Cruickshank Sanctuary, a 140-acre wildlife refuge near Rockledge, Florida. The Florida Ornithological Society sponsors the Helen G. and Allan D. Cruickshank Education Award.
